Rawshot AI is an EU-built AI fashion photography platform that replaces prompt engineering with a click-driven graphical interface where camera, pose, lighting, background, composition, and visual style are controlled through buttons, sliders, and presets. Developed by Global Commerce Media GmbH, it generates original on-model imagery and video of real garments while preserving garment attributes such as cut, color, pattern, logo, fabric, and drape. The platform supports consistent synthetic models across large catalogs, synthetic composite models built from 28 body attributes, more than 150 visual style presets, and compositions with up to four products. Rawshot AI embeds compliance and transparency into every output through C2PA-signed provenance metadata, multi-layer watermarking, explicit AI labeling, and logged generation documentation for audit trails. It also grants users full permanent commercial rights and supports both browser-based creative workflows and REST API integrations for catalog-scale automation.

Pixa is a general-purpose AI creative platform for creating, editing, and exporting production-ready visuals for brands, businesses, and creators. It offers product image generation, background removal, image upscaling, AI video generation, AI ads, and custom personas from a single workspace. In fashion-adjacent workflows, Pixa supports a dedicated virtual try-on API that visualizes clothing on people, preserves garment details, and adapts outfits across body types and poses. Pixa serves e-commerce and marketing teams that need fast product content, but it is broader creative software rather than a specialized AI fashion photography platform.
